Shawna Brackens, 55, of New Albany, Indiana, passed away on Sunday, August 11, 2024.

Shawna Brackens was a free-lance writer,Artist, poet, game developer and author. She has won numerous awards for literary excellence. Shawna has been honored as an International Poet of Merit. Her writings have been selected for the Town Poet section of The New Albany Tribune . Her poems are showcased in over 30 publications nationally and internationally. In 1997, Shawna was formally inducted into the International Poetry Hall of Fame. Shawna was also nominated as Poet of the Year-1997. Her first book, The outskirts of Bethlehem, is a collection of selected poetry. Her second book, Born to Be Great, is a motivational book on purpose and destiny. Her third book, Match Game, is a fun, educational book for children of all ages. Her fourth book, Soul Source, was co- author with a group of friends, Stories of women who relied on GOD during difficult times. Her Fifth book, keep the Beat: The rhythm of a awarding speech. Focus on speech development and delivery. The traveler Shawna has traveled to over twenty-five nations as well 49 United States, She never let's dust settle under her feet. 

The humanitarian: 

She was the President of The Potter's House Fellowship International, the Founder of The W.H.EW. Global Platform and A Piece of Bread, Inc. She also sponsored and founded educational institutions in Africa and supported churches in Korea. 

The Education:

She is a graduate of Indiana University and was a certified TESO.L instructor. Shawna also attend Bible College where she received her Doctors of divinity.

Some of her honors: 

The Rosa Parks Award, Outstanding Educator of the Year, and Korea Toast- masters National Speech Evaluation Champion, just to name a few.

Shawna was a worldwide evangelist preacher and teacher. She loved God and she loved his people. She lived her dream of being a self-supported servant in East Asia. Her goal in life is to be an example word, hope, and charity.

Shawna had a warm robust smile, and a contagious laughter. Her go was to make your day. She was so funny you'd laugh and cry at the same time as she enthusiastically entertained. Shawna will be missed by many friend and family world wide. As Shawna would say" I love you , NOW GO BE GREAT!"

Shawna is survived by her siblings, Odell, Jr. (Blanche), George, Kevin, Henry, Steven Brackens, Renita McCloud, DeVonne Whiting, Lisa Sheppard, and Trina Brackens; God son, Keith Simmons; and numerous nieces, nephews and cousins.

Visitation will be from 11:00 am to 12:00 pm on Saturday, August 24, 2024 at Greater Mount Zion Apostolic Church, (3845 Wayne Street, New Albany, Indiana) with her funeral service taking place at 12:00 pm.
